How to File Safety Reports at PAM Transport: A Step-by-Step Guide

Filing safety reports is a crucial part of maintaining safety standards at PAM Transport. This step-by-step guide will help you navigate the process efficiently and ensure compliance with company policies and regulations.

Understanding the Importance of Safety Reports

Safety reports help identify potential hazards, track incidents, and improve overall safety conditions. Proper reporting ensures that issues are addressed promptly and that the company maintains its commitment to a safe working environment.

Prerequisites for Filing Safety Reports

  • Access to the PAM Transport safety reporting portal
  • Knowledge of the incident details
  • Relevant documentation or evidence (photos, witness statements)
  • Employee identification or login credentials

Step-by-Step Guide to Filing Safety Reports

Step 1: Log into the Safety Reporting Portal

Visit the PAM Transport safety portal website and enter your login credentials. If you do not have access, contact your supervisor to obtain the necessary permissions.

Step 2: Navigate to the Safety Report Section

Once logged in, locate the “Safety Reports” tab in the main menu. Click on it to access the reporting form.

Step 3: Fill Out the Safety Report Form

Provide detailed information about the incident or hazard. Include the date, time, location, and a clear description of what occurred. Attach any supporting documents or photos if available.

Step 4: Review and Submit

Review all entered information for accuracy. Once confirmed, click the “Submit” button to file the report. You will receive a confirmation receipt.

After Filing the Report

Follow up on your report if necessary. Contact your supervisor or safety officer for updates or additional information requests. Remember to keep a copy of the confirmation for your records.
